1. What is the estimated cost of creating an R2-D2 costume?

The cost varies depending on the materials used, level of detail, and skill of the builder. On average, expect to invest between $2,500 to $6,000.

2. How long does it take to build an R2-D2 costume?

Depending on the complexity and available time, the construction process typically takes between 3 to 6 months.

3. What are the most challenging aspects of building an R2-D2 costume?

Achieving accurate proportions, creating the retractable legs, and integrating the electronics are some of the most demanding aspects.

4. Are there any safety considerations when operating an R2-D2 costume?

Yes, ensure proper ventilation, limit exposure to extreme temperatures, and avoid operating the costume in crowded or hazardous areas.

5. Can I rent an R2-D2 costume instead of building one?

Yes, costume rental services or prop houses may offer R2-D2 costumes for rent.

6. Where can I find inspiration and guidance for building an R2-D2 costume?

Numerous online forums, fan clubs, and reference materials are available to provide inspiration, technical advice, and community support.
